Duties:

 

JOB TITLE: Furnace Technician, Electrical Team Leader

REPORTING TO: Maintenance Manager Team

DEPARTMENT: Maintenance

S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ITY: Along with the Maintenance Management team plan and

supervise the work load of the electricians, contractors and assist with the training of Somers

Apprentices. Deputise for the Maintenance Management Team when required.

JOB PURPOSE: improve furnace reliability, plan and review furnace survey schedules, plan and

organise and oversee furnace instrument calibrations. Carry out thermocouple calibration and

replacement programs.

MAIN D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ES: On a daily basis, check all furnaces are working

correctly. Check all qualified furnaces are operating within the specifications of their qualification

and sign off the charts, maintain a daily log reporting the above.

Attend to and repair any fault that may occur on a furnace.

On a weekly basis carry out system accuracy tests (SATS) on all qualified furnaces and produce

documents to log results. On a monthly basis carry out preventative maintenance checks on a

rolling program on all furnaces.

Plan and review all furnace instrument calibration sign certificates and keep documents in a

register. Manufacture, calibrate and re-calibrate Type R thermocouples and keep in a register.

Replace Type K thermocouples and keep in a register. Issue certificates of calibration to each

surveyed furnace, to each thermocouple Type R and Type K and for each furnace denoting where

each thermocouple is located its' date of issue and the date showing next calibration due.

KEEP AND MAINTAIN ALL CALIBRATION RECORDS.
